Largest Available Willow Park and Nearby 3 Bedroom Apartments

The largest available 3 Bedroom apartment unit in Willow Park, TX is found at Willow Crossing Townhomes in the Willow Wood neighborhood and is 2,154 square feet priced from $2,300. Stone Lake Townhomes in the Downtown Weatherford neighborhood has the second largest 3 Bedroom, which is sized at 1,817 square feet and currently listed start at $2,275. Cheapest Available Willow Park and Nearby 3 Bedroom Apartments

As of June 23, 2026 the lowest priced 3 Bedroom apartment unit in Willow Park, TX is the Upstairs Villa Model starting from $1,399 at Woodhaven Villas in the Downtown Weatherford neighborhood. The second most affordable Willow Park 3 Bedroom is the C-1 Model at The Cassidy at Western Hills starting at $1,425 in the North Fort Worth neighborhood. The average price for all 3 Bedroom apartments in Willow Park is currently $2,162. Here is today’s list of the cheapest available 3 Bedroom options in Willow Park:

Frequently Asked Questions about 3 Bedroom Willow Park Apartments

How much is the average rent for a 3 Bedroom Willow Park Apartment?

The average rent for a 3 Bedroom Apartment in Willow Park is $2,162.

What is the largest available 3 Bedroom Willow Park Apartment for rent?

Today's apartment with the most square footage in Willow Park is a 2,154 square feet unit starting from $2,300 at Willow Crossing Townhomes.

What is the average size for Willow Park 3 Bedroom Apartments for rent?

The average size for a 3 Bedroom rental in Willow Park is currently 1,829 sq ft.
